网上订餐系统毕业论文

网上订餐系统毕业论文
网上订餐系统毕业论文

大学

毕业设计(论文)

题目__ 网上订餐系统

学生

专业班级

学号

院(系)

指导教师(职称)

完成时间2014 年04月11日

目录

论文摘要 (4)

一、引言 (6)

二、系统概述 (7)

(一)可行性分析 (7)

(二)需求分析 (8)

1.用户需求分析 (8)

2.管理员需求分析 (8)

3.系统用例图 (9)

(1)用户用例图 (9)

(2)管理员用例图 (9)

(三)功能描述 (10)

三、系统总体设计 (10)

(一)系统设计 (10)

1.逻辑结构分析 (10)

2.功能模块划分 (11)

3.系统流程概述 (12)

4.系统主要类图 (13)

(二)系统流程 (14)

1.前台界面 (14)

2.后台界面 (15)

(三)数据库设计 (15)

1.数据库的概念设计 (15)

(1)管理员实体 (15)

(2)用户实体 (16)

(3)餐品实体 (17)

(4)订单实体 (17)

(5)系统总E-R图 (18)

2.数据库的逻辑设计 (18)

3.数据库的物理结构设计 (19)

(1)用户信息表(userinfo) (19)

(2)管理员信息表(admininfo) (20)

(3)餐品信息表(canpininfo) (20)

(4)订单信息表(orderinfo) (21)

四、系统详细设计与实现 (21)

(一)运用平台或环境 (21)

(二)实现主要技术简介 (22)

1.JavaServer Pages (JSP)技术 (22)

2.最佳JSP应用服务器Tomcat (22)

3.JDK配置 (23)

4.Myeclipse简介 (24)

5.SQL Server 2005 简介 (24)

6.Servlet简介 (25)

(三)数据库的连接 (26)

(四)系统详细设计(界面设计) (27)

1.用户登录界面 (27)

2.用户注册界面 (29)

3.用户查看购物车界面 (30)

4.用户生成订单界面 (33)

5.管理员修改餐品信息界面 (34)

(五)实现方法 (36)

1.系统配置 (36)

2.页面设计 (36)

3.用户管理 (36)

五、结束语 (37)

致 (38)

参考文献 (39)

网上订餐系统的设计与实现

论文摘要

网上订餐系统是用户实现网络交易的一种方式。设计和实现了一个B/S结构的网上订餐系统,着重论述了系统的功能与实现、数据流程及存储。包括餐品信息介绍、网上订餐、用户登录、用户注册、以及对订餐车的操作,包括将餐品加入购物车和从购物车中将餐品删除等功能,当用户决定订购后,可以点击购物车中确认订购一项,生成订单提交给后台数据库,用户也可以查询自己订单的状态查看是否订单应经被受理等。使用图文并茂(功能代码及截图)的方式,对整个网上订餐系统功能模块的实现方法进行阐述和分析。本系统主要是针对那些具备计算机管理工作条件的餐饮企业助其快速开发一个界面友好、与客户交互方便的网上订餐系统,以拓展餐饮企业的服务对象,增加信息流通量,减少人工干预,提高信息反馈速度。它能够实现普通用户通过互联网订餐,节省购餐时间等功能。其前台运用JavaScript技术、servlet、jsp开发语言,实现用户订餐页面友好的界面互动,主要通过SQL Server 2005、Tomcat、jdbc等实现数据库的连接。

关键词网上订餐系统SQL Server 2005 jsp servlet

网上订餐系统的设计与实现

XXX

(XX大学XXXX学院XXXXX专业)

一、引言

人类的文明始于饮食,西汉司马迁在《史记·郦生陆贾列传》中写道:“王者以民人为天,而民人以食为天”。可见饮食在人类生活中占有十分重要的地位。离开饮食将无法生存,当然也就谈不上社会的存在和各种文化现象的发展。人类的饮食文明,经过生食、熟食、烹饪三个阶段。随着社会的发展,食物种类的丰富,人们开始注重食物的色、香、味、形,烹调方法上也有了千变万化,在中国的烹调技艺上,发展出了“炸、炒、熘、爆、炖、煸(bian)、煮、焖、烤、烧、扒、烩、煎、涮、蒸等多种制作方法,并形成了“鲁菜、菜、粤菜、川菜、浙菜、闽菜、湘菜、徽菜八大菜系,餐饮已作为一个行业存在于现代文明社会中,成为国民经济的重要组成部分。

二十一世纪是信息化、知识化的世纪,随着社会的进步、计算机应用的迅猛发展和网络应用的不断扩大,使传统的订餐形式得到了极大的扩充,使人们订餐更加的便捷。基于Java Web的网上订餐系统,就是这样一种基于计算机网络的网上订餐形式,它的出现,大扩展了现行的订餐方式,使餐饮摆脱了空间上和时间上的约束,无论谁,只要会上网,都可以坐在电脑前面,方便地进行上网订餐,可以说是对餐饮业的一次革命。相比传统的订餐方式,网上订餐系统的主要优点是:

便捷性。网上订餐系统使用非常方便,只要是能够上网的地方,人们都能够轻松使用系统的所有功能。在传统的订餐方式中,顾客要么是到餐馆去,但是由于可能工作忙而没有时间去餐馆,这样餐馆就失去了一名顾客,而打,也会有一定的费用。而使用了网上订餐系统后,这些问题都没有了。

可扩展性。而今网络技术突飞猛进,发展迅速,新技术的产生速度是以前的数十倍。网上订餐给顾客留下非常深刻的视觉印象,增加潜在的订餐顾客。所以可以肯定地说,网上订餐的前景是非常广阔的,可扩展性非常的好。

因此,开发一个餐馆信息系统是十分必要的,通过前台的菜品信息展示,通过购物车的模式形成餐饮企业的电子商务平台,通过后台整合餐饮的供应链,提高其在信息化条件下的管理水平,对现在激烈竞争的餐饮行业中求发展的餐饮企业来说,无疑是一个福音。

二、系统概述

本系统的全称为网上订餐系统,系统的设计目的是为了满足消费者只要通过互联网就可以足不出户的订购自己喜欢的餐品,改变传统的商业交易方式,让消费者在互联网上就可以进行交易,实现网上购买餐品,同时也提高了各个餐饮店的利润,并方便了饭店对

餐饮的管理.

(一)可行性分析

随着全国的物质、精神和文化生活的高度提高,人们已经不再仅仅停留在吃饱的程度,而人民是不但要吃饱,还要吃好,并且越来越挑剔,也正因为如此,网上订餐业务的出现,正好迎合了这些人的口味,他们不但省去了自己做饭的麻烦,而且也能寻找和发现新的菜种,品尝不同风格和不同种类的菜品,网上订餐业务在中国有着极大的发展空间和良好的发展前景。

网上订餐业务的兴起,折射出餐饮业善抓机遇、抢占利润第二落点的经营理念,同

相关主题
相关文档
最新文档